Effect of Video Games on Cognitive Performance and Problem-Solving Ability in the Aged with Cognitive Dysfunction: A
Mosayeb Mozafari1, Masoumeh Otaghi1, Maryam Paskseresht1
1Department of Nursing, Faculty of Nursing and Midwifery, Ilam University of Medical Sciences, Ilam, Iran.
Playing video games three times weekly for 12 weeks significantly improved cognitive performance and problem-solving skills in elderly individuals with mild cognitive impairment. This intervention is recommended for enhancing brain health in aging populations.

Background:
- Mild cognitive impairment (MCI) is a common aging issue.
- Impaired problem-solving abilities are linked to memory decline in the elderly.
- This study addresses the need for interventions to support cognitive function in aging populations.
Purpose of the Study:
- To investigate the impact of video games on cognitive performance in elderly individuals with MCI.
- To assess the effect of video games on problem-solving abilities in this demographic.
- To explore a novel, accessible intervention for cognitive enhancement in older adults.
Main Methods:
- A double-blind, randomized clinical trial involving 60 elderly participants with MCI.
- Intervention group played smartphone video games thrice weekly for 12 weeks; control group received no intervention.
- Cognitive performance and problem-solving were assessed using the Mini Mental Status Examination and Problem-solving Questionnaire at baseline, 8 weeks, and 4 weeks post-intervention.
Main Results:
- The intervention group showed significant improvements in cognitive performance (25.18±0.93) and problem-solving ability (21.15±1.36) compared to the control group (19.43±0.76 and 13.72±1.98, respectively) (P<0.001).
- No significant baseline differences were observed between groups.
- Significant differences emerged 8 weeks after intervention initiation and persisted 4 weeks post-intervention (P<0.001).
Conclusions:
- Regular engagement with video games can effectively enhance cognitive performance and problem-solving skills in the elderly with MCI.
- This video game intervention is a promising, implementable strategy for improving cognitive health in aging populations.
- The findings support the integration of digital interventions into geriatric care to mitigate cognitive decline.
